What Impression Do Visitors Get of Your Daycare?
If you answer “no” to any of these questions, consider those the areas your church can improve upon.
Last Name:  First Name: 
1
Are visitors made to feel welcome?

2
Is there a safe procedure for gaining access to the facility?

3
Are there enough caregivers to handle the number of children?

4
Do caregivers interact with children in a positive manner?

5
Are all children constantly supervised by more than one adult?

6
Do caregivers and children appear happy and healthy?

7
Does the facility look and smell clean?

8
Is outdoor play equipment sturdy, well-anchored, and in good repair?

9
Is ground under play equipment well-cushioned?

10
Are play materials clean, in good-repair, and age-appropriate?

11
Are activities age-appropriate and reflective of the interests of the children?

12
Are hazardous materials such as medicines and cleaning supplies locked away?
